The reports of the leaders of the ruling party «Georgian Dream» contradict the pro-European course of Georgia, go in unison with Russia and are defeatist. This was stated by President Salome Zurabishvili.
On the eve of the «Georgian Dream» Chairman Irakli Kobakhidze said that Russia now has an advantage in the war with Ukraine. He also criticizes the authorities of Ukraine for requests for treatment abroad by Georgian ex-president Mikheil Saakashvili. Kobakhidze also supported the resumption of air communication between Georgia and Russia.
According to Salome Zurabishvili, such statements are difficult to find explanations. They are also made by MPs from the ruling party. Earlier Zurabishvili actually condemned the court’s refusal to release Mikheil Saakashvili for treatment abroad.
